    Save your spot for ASCE’s International Conference on Transportation & Development

    The Transportation & Development Institute (T&DI) of the American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E) is organizing ASCE’s International Conference on Transportation & Development (ICTD) this year, which will take place in Pittsburg, Pennsylvania this July.

    The ICTD is set to be held from July 15-18 at the Wyndham Grand Pittsburg Downtown Hotel. This year’s conference is co-chaired by Yinhai Wang, a professor in Civil and Environmental Engineering at the University of Washington and the director of PacTrans UTC Region 10, and Mike McNerney, a research professor at the University of Texas at Arlington. Additionally, the two are responsible for organizing the UTC Technology Transfer Workshop.

    Technology continues to develop in our world at an increasingly rapid rate, meaning that there is a growing need to asses and prepare for the inevitable impact it will have on transportation and development.

    The ICTD gives practitioners, researchers, leaders, policy makers, engineers, planners, students, and other individuals that are interested and invested in the realm of transportation and development the opportunity to exchange information, share their best practices, and advance their knowledge on the transportation sector.

    The conference will feature a variety of speakers, designated workshops, and technical programs and tours, all allowing participants to learn about innovations in technology and their impact on transportation, network with professionals that are heavily involved with infrastructure, get updated on new policies and initiatives, and earn professional development hours.

    The T&DI of ASCE is an organization devoted to transportation, development, and the professionals within the industry. It is one of the ASCE’s nine specialty institutions and is dedicated to promoting professional excellence in the realm of transportation engineering, urban planning, and overall development.
